Use Add Printers & Scanners
The new Windows Settings world works the same as in the Control Panel, simply it looks different enough to crusade defoliation for some. Notation that if this is at work and you're non an administrator, the printer must be on the network and the driver already installed. If information technology'southward not installed, you'll become a prompt to enter the administrator business relationship name and password.
- In the Outset card, type add printers. When the effect Add a printer or scanner shows, select it.
- When the Printers & scanners window opens, select Add together a printer or scanner. It will start searching for available printers.
- It may look like it'southward still searching, even though all the printers available are showing. Find the printer needed, select it, and then the Add device button volition show. Select it.
- The printer will install. There'll exist a progress bar and when it's done, information technology'll say Ready.
Connect to a Network Printer Through a Network Share
Here'southward a way to install a printer that'south different from what you may exist used to. It requires that the printer is shared and on the network. Unless y'all're the administrator, the driver needs to be installed on your local machine or server. Y'all need to know the path to the share also. It will look something similar \\Print-Server-Proper name, where Print-Server-proper name is the proper name of the server.
- Open File Explorer. In the location bar, enter the printer share path and then press the enter fundamental. File Explorer will observe the share.
All the shared printers will show.
- There are ii options:
- Install a single printer
- Install several printers at one fourth dimension
To install a single printer, double-click on it.
When the installation finishes, you'll see the newly installed printer's print queue window.
- To install several printers at once, select printers past clicking and dragging a rectangle effectually them, or hold downwards the Ctrl key while selecting printers individually. Either right-click and select Open or simply press the Enter key.
Connect to Network Printer via Control Panel
The proficient old command console is still in that location. If you've used it before, y'all know what to do. If not, it'due south almost the aforementioned equally adding a printer through Settings.
- Open the Start menu and select Control Panel. If information technology's not there, start typing control and information technology will show.
- Select Add a device in the Hardware category.
- Select Add a printer.
- It will bear witness a selection of printers. Select the 1 needed so select Next.
The printer will outset installing. Information technology may take a few seconds or minutes.
- Once the success window opens, there are options to Set as the default printer and Impress a test page. Set the printer as default if needed. It'south always a good idea to print a exam page. To get out, select Finish.
Connect to Network Printer via IP Address
The printer you want to install might non be hands visible, but if you accept the IP address for information technology you can employ that to connect with the printer. Administrator rights may exist required. The get-go office is the same as adding a printer through the Control Panel until you go to the step to choose the printer. Let'due south pick information technology upwards from there.
- At the Add a device window, select The printer that I desire isn't listed.
- If administrator rights are required, select Add a local or network printer as an ambassador.
Otherwise, the window beneath volition evidence. Select Add a printer using TCP/IP accost or hostname then select Next.
- For Device type: there are several choices. Web Services Device and Web Services Secure Print Device are used for special cases. If yous don't know what those hateful, you lot probably don't need them. Autodetect may brand the incorrect choice as well. Select TCP/IP Device.
Enter the IP address in the Hostname or IP address: field. Notice how the Port name: field machine-populates with whatever is entered. The port name can be left as is or changed. In most cases, Query the printer and automatically select the driver to employ remains checked.
Sometimes an organization will use a universal printer driver to keep things simpler and use less storage. It besides keeps the registry modest and login times faster. The HP Universal Print Driver works well for HP and many other printers. Select Next.
It detects the TCP/IP port to come across if information technology exists.
Then information technology detects the driver model needed.
- Normally, Windows will notice a driver already installed, offer the selection to replace the driver, or enquire to install a driver. If it's on the network already, information technology probably installed the driver already. Select Use the driver that is currently installed and select Side by side.
- Information technology will machine-select a name for the printer. That tin change as needed. Select Next.
The real installation begins.
- If sharing the printer, add a location so others can see where the printer is located.
It successfully installed the printer. Set information technology as the default or not as needed. Every bit always, it's a good idea to Print a test folio. Select Finish closes out the window.
Connect to a Network Printer via PowerShell
Finally, the last, and maybe best, way to connect network printers is with PowerShell. Why is this all-time? If you're a System Administrator and take dozens of printers to connect, or if you need to make certain the printer is connected every time the server starts or someone logs in, a PowerShell script is all-time. Information technology'due south fast, done once, and easy to call many times.
You will need to know:
- Printer IP accost
- Printer driver name
- What to name the printer
Following is a sample script. Go far into a looping script to install several printers at a fourth dimension, or make it a function to call from other processes.
# check if a printer port exists
$portName = "TCPPort:192.168.8.101"
$portExist = Get-Printerport -Name $portName -ErrorAction SilentlyContinue
# if port doesn't be, add it
if (-not $portExists) {
Add-PrinterPort -proper noun $portName -PrinterHostAddress "192.168.8.101"
}
# cheque for print commuter
$driverName = "Brother MFC-7440N"
$driverExists = Get-PrinterDriver -name $driverName -ErrorAction SilentlyContinue
# add printer if driver exists or else throw an error
if ($driverExists) {
Add-Printer -Proper name "My Brother Printer" -PortName $portName -DriverName $driverName
} else {
Write-Alert "Driver non installed" -ForegroundColor Red
}
When the script is run, information technology takes mayhap 3 seconds. And then you'll see the printer installed.
